#Appropedia - "Curdled milk paint recipe

The following is a recipe for quark, or curdled milk, based paint. Quark is a Casein Paint. The recipe is very specific but casein paints last a long time, are fungi resistant and compostable. Casein paints can be used inside or outside, on wood, stone, drywall, wallpaper, earthen plaster, masonry and to cover existing painted surfaces.

Milk paint is suggested for areas that will be subject to moisture. Milk paint is good for these areas because the borax (or lime) has antibacterial and anti-molding properties. When milk paint is dried it has a glassy surface that is wipeable.

There is a lot of preparation that goes into making milk paint. Both the chalk and the pigment must be slaked the night before. #Slaking is soaking a dry powder in water overnight so that the ingredient will mix with water in a more consistent smooth manner."

#Appropedia - #NaturalPaints

"Natural paint is often a safer and more local alternative to conventional paints that can be high in VOCs and emboddied energy.

This page describes natural paints as a potential component of United States of America home construction. Only a few decades ago, the petrochemical industry largely took over the production of oil-based and water-based paints. The idea that paint should be able to breath was abandoned. Also, added synthetic chemicals are very harmful to humans and animals. Natural paints derived from plant and mineral materials have subtle, soothing colors, pleasant scents, and help create a healthy environment. Natural paints avoid indoor air pollution and can have an unusual, attractive appearance.

Advantages:
- Using natural paint can reduce the amount of VOCs present in the home, improving indoor air quality.
- Natural paints are microporous, allowing the walls to breathe. Because moisture is not trapped between the wall and the layer of paint, there is no blistering or peeling.
- Natural paints do not use petroleum products and contain ingredients from sustainable sources.
- Because of their non-toxic, natural ingredients, many natural paints are biodegradable, easily disposed of and even fit for a household compost pile once dried. This reduces landfill mass, environmental pollution and disposal costs compared to synthetic paints.

Disadvantages:
- Natural paints, especially store bought, may be more expensive than synthetic paints.
- Natural paints may be more difficult to work with than synthetic paints because of texture, rate of drying and inconsistent coloring from batch to batch.
- Although anecdotally durable and resistant, there is a lack of performance data on natural paints, so it is important to test natural paint before committing to a contract."

Tolocar Playbook

Toloka is a traditional way of showing solidarity through the provision of physical support in Ukraine. With that in mind, German and Ukrainian partners with support from the Deutsche Gesellschaft für Internationale Zusammenarbeit (GIZ) co-created the Tolocar project just a few weeks after the start of the full-scale Russian* invasion of Ukraine. The goal of the project is to support both the emergency relief activities, and the development of a participatory innovation ecosystem for the socio-economic recovery of Ukraine.
